You only need 2 urinals. 1 full size, one wheelchair accessible.  The rest can be toilets.  Urinals are a convenience item. The issue of "Standing next to another guy" goes away totally when there are this few of them, and the the "Stand, zip, rip, flush, zip, wash hands" nature of the process for "Gotta go quick, and get back to doing whatever" (Such as "Gotta pee at the movies", or "Boss is a dickhead, does not like toilet breaks", or "I'm a trucker, and time spent in the bathroom is time my manager is up my ass", etc.)

For places that expect to serve lots of alcohol, they are also a "Lets avoid having piss all over everything" solution as well, because they combine "Fast service" with "high density", but that only makes sense for places like civic arenas, or the like, where heavy drinking is expected to happen.

But for a normal public restroom? No. 2 urinals. One full size, one wheelchair accessible.  That's all you need in terms of urinals.

Depends.  Urinals can be "low capacity flush" but they often REEK if they are-- meaning people flush more than once completely negating that advantage. Likewise, there are low capacity (air assisted flush) toilets, which are quite effective.  I would say that for cost saving measures, you can do more with the toilet than you can with the urinal.  Urinal is mostly for the convenience.
